版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
2026年计算机科学与技术专业考研模拟单套试卷考试时长:120分钟满分:100分考核对象:计算机科学与技术专业考研考生试卷总分:100分一、单选题(总共10题,每题2分,共20分)1.在面向对象编程中,以下哪种设计原则强调保持类的独立性,避免类之间过度依赖?A.开放封闭原则B.单一职责原则C.接口隔离原则D.里氏替换原则2.下列数据结构中,最适合用于实现快速插入和删除操作的是?A.链表B.数组C.堆D.树3.在分布式系统中,CAP定理指出系统最多只能同时满足以下哪两项?A.一致性、可用性、分区容错性B.一致性、分区容错性、可扩展性C.可用性、分区容错性、可扩展性D.一致性、可用性、可扩展性4.以下哪种加密算法属于对称加密?A.RSAB.AESC.ECCD.SHA-2565.在图论中,以下哪种算法用于寻找无向图中所有顶点对的最短路径?A.Dijkstra算法B.Floyd-Warshall算法C.Bellman-Ford算法D.A算法6.以下哪种数据库模型支持事务性操作和并发控制?A.层次模型B.网状模型C.关系模型D.对象模型7.在机器学习中,以下哪种算法属于监督学习?A.K-means聚类B.主成分分析(PCA)C.决策树分类D.自组织映射(SOM)8.以下哪种网络协议用于实现可靠的数据传输?A.UDPB.TCPC.ICMPD.HTTP9.在操作系统内核中,以下哪种机制用于管理进程的执行顺序?A.调度算法B.内存分配C.文件系统D.设备驱动10.在编译原理中,以下哪种技术用于优化代码执行效率?A.语法分析B.语义分析C.代码生成D.符号表管理参考答案:1.B2.A3.A4.B5.B6.C7.C8.B9.A10.C---二、多选题(总共10题,每题2分,共20分)1.以下哪些属于面向对象编程的特性?A.封装B.继承C.多态D.抽象E.泛型2.以下哪些数据结构支持动态内存分配?A.链表B.数组C.堆D.栈E.队列3.在分布式系统中,以下哪些属于常见的共识算法?A.PaxosB.RaftC.ByzantineFaultToleranceD.CAPE.BGP4.以下哪些属于对称加密算法?A.DESB.3DESC.AESD.RSAE.Blowfish5.在图论中,以下哪些算法用于解决最短路径问题?A.Dijkstra算法B.Floyd-Warshall算法C.Bellman-Ford算法D.A算法E.Kruskal算法6.以下哪些属于关系数据库的ACID特性?A.原子性B.一致性C.隔离性D.持久性E.可恢复性7.在机器学习中,以下哪些属于无监督学习算法?A.K-means聚类B.决策树分类C.主成分分析(PCA)D.自组织映射(SOM)E.支持向量机(SVM)8.以下哪些网络协议属于传输层协议?A.TCPB.UDPC.ICMPD.HTTPE.FTP9.在操作系统内核中,以下哪些属于进程管理机制?A.进程调度B.进程创建C.进程终止D.内存分配E.设备分配10.在编译原理中,以下哪些属于代码优化技术?A.循环展开B.代码生成C.基于图的分析D.符号表管理E.基本块分析参考答案:1.ABCD2.ACD3.AB4.ABC5.ABCD6.ABCD7.ACD8.AB9.ABC10.ACE---三、判断题(总共10题,每题2分,共20分)1.快速排序算法的平均时间复杂度为O(n^2)。2.在分布式系统中,CAP定理意味着系统无法同时保证一致性和分区容错性。3.对称加密算法的密钥长度通常比非对称加密算法的密钥长度更长。4.Floyd-Warshall算法可以用于求解有向图中所有顶点对的最短路径。5.关系数据库中的外键用于保证数据的一致性。6.决策树算法属于监督学习算法。7.TCP协议通过三次握手建立连接,UDP协议不需要建立连接。8.操作系统中的中断机制用于处理硬件事件。9.编译器中的语法分析阶段用于检查代码的语法正确性。10.机器学习中的过拟合是指模型在训练数据上表现良好,但在测试数据上表现差。参考答案:1.×2.√3.×4.√5.√6.√7.√8.√9.√10.√---四、简答题(总共3题,每题4分,共12分)1.简述面向对象编程的四大基本特性及其含义。2.解释什么是分布式系统的分区容错性,并举例说明其重要性。3.简述机器学习中过拟合和欠拟合的概念,并分别提出一种解决方法。参考答案:1.面向对象编程的四大基本特性:-封装:将数据和行为绑定在一起,隐藏内部实现细节。-继承:允许一个类继承另一个类的属性和方法,实现代码复用。-多态:允许不同类的对象对同一消息做出不同的响应。-抽象:通过抽象类或接口定义通用行为,隐藏具体实现。2.分区容错性是指系统在部分节点或网络链路失效时仍能继续运行的能力。例如,在分布式数据库中,即使部分节点宕机,系统仍能通过数据冗余和容错机制保证数据一致性和服务可用性。3.过拟合是指模型在训练数据上表现极好,但在测试数据上表现差;欠拟合是指模型在训练数据上表现也不好。解决方法:-过拟合:增加数据量、使用正则化、简化模型。-欠拟合:增加模型复杂度、增加训练数据、调整超参数。---五、应用题(总共2题,每题9分,共18分)1.假设有一个无向图G,顶点集为{A,B,C,D,E},边集为{(A,B),(A,C),(B,C),(B,D),(C,E)}。请使用Dijkstra算法求顶点A到其他所有顶点的最短路径。解题思路:-初始化:将所有顶点的距离设为无穷大,A的距离设为0。-更新距离:每次选择未访问顶点中距离最小的顶点,更新其邻接顶点的距离。-结果:最终得到A到其他顶点的最短路径。参考答案:-A到B:A-B,距离1。-A到C:A-C,距离1。-A到D:A-B-D,距离2。-A到E:A-C-E,距离2。2.假设有一个关系数据库表“学生”(学号,姓名,专业,成绩),请写出SQL语句:-查询所有计算机专业的学生及其成绩。-查询平均成绩最高的专业。解题思路:-使用`SELECT`语句结合`WHERE`子句过滤专业。-使用`GROUPBY`和`ORDERBY`子句计算平均成绩并排序。参考答案:-查询计算机专业学生:```sqlSELECT学号,姓名,专业,成绩FROM学生WHERE专业='计算机';```-查询平均成绩最高的专业:```sqlSELECT专业,AVG(成绩)AS平均成绩FROM学生GROUPBY专业ORDERBY平均成绩DESCLIMIT1;```---标准答案及解析一、单选题1.B单一职责原则强调一个类只负责一项职责,避免过度耦合。2.A链表支持动态插入和删除操作,时间复杂度为O(1)。3.ACAP定理指出系统最多只能同时满足一致性、可用性和分区容错性中的两项。4.BAES是对称加密算法,RSA和ECC是非对称加密算法,SHA-256是哈希算法。5.BFloyd-Warshall算法用于求解无向图中所有顶点对的最短路径。6.C关系模型支持事务性操作和并发控制,是关系数据库的基础。7.C决策树分类属于监督学习,K-means和PCA是无监督学习,SOM是聚类算法。8.BTCP协议提供可靠的数据传输,UDP协议不可靠。9.A调度算法用于管理进程的执行顺序,其他选项与进程调度无关。10.C代码生成是编译器的最后阶段,用于优化代码执行效率。二、多选题1.ABCD面向对象编程的四大特性是封装、继承、多态和抽象。2.ACD链表、堆和栈支持动态内存分配,数组不支持。3.ABPaxos和Raft是共识算法,ByzantineFaultTolerance是容错算法,CAP是定理,BGP是路由协议。4.ABCDES、3DES、AES和Blowfish是对称加密算法,RSA是公钥加密算法。5.ABCDDijkstra、Floyd-Warshall、Bellman-Ford和A算法用于求解最短路径问题,Kruskal算法用于最小生成树。6.ABCD关系数据库的ACID特性是原子性、一致性、隔离性和持久性。7.ACDK-means、PCA和SOM是无监督学习算法,决策树和SVM是监督学习算法。8.ABTCP和UDP是传输层协议,ICMP是网络层协议,HTTP和FTP是应用层协议。9.ABC进程管理包括进程调度、创建和终止,内存分配和设备分配属于资源管理。10.ACE循环展开、基于图的分析和基本块分析是代码优化技术,代码生成和符号表管理不属于优化技术。三、判断题1.×快速排序的平均时间复杂度为O(nlogn)。2.√CAP定理意味着系统无法同时满足一致性和分区容错性。3.×对称加密算法的密钥长度通常比非对称加密算法的密钥长度短。4.√Floyd-Warshall算法可以求解有向图的最短路径。5.√外键用于保证数据的一致性。6.√决策树算法属于监督学习算法。7.√TCP需要三次握手,UDP不需要。8.√中断机制用于处理硬件事件。9.√语法分析阶段用于检查代码的语法正确性。10.√过拟合是指模型在训练数据上表现良好,但在测试数据上表现差。四、简答题1.面向对象编程的四大基本特性:-封装:将数据和行为绑定在一起,隐藏内部实现细节。-继承:允许一个类继承另一个类的属性和方法,实现代码复用。-多态:允许不同类的对象对同一消息做出不同的响应。-抽象:通过抽象类或接口定义通用行为,隐藏具体实现。2.分区容错性是指系统在部分节点或网络链路失效时仍能继续运行的能力。例如,在分布式数据库中,即使部分节点宕机,系统仍能通过数据冗余和容错机制保证数据一致性和服务可用性。3.过拟合是指模型在训练数据上表现极好,但在测试数据上表现差;欠拟合是指模型在训练数据上表现也不好。解决方法:-过拟合:增加数据量、使用正则化、简化模型。-欠拟合:增加模型复杂度、增加训练数据、调整超参数。五、应用题1.Dijkstra算法求解最短路径:-初始化:A到A距离为0,其他顶点距离为无穷大。-更新距离:-A到B:距离1。-A到C:距离1。-
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 医院感染控制工作计划
- 2026年家居孵化工业互联网合同
- 2026年快消顾问仓储托管协议
- 2026年航天投资租赁托管协议
- 2026年物流孵化新能源建设协议
- 2026年大数据服务智能硬件协议
- 2026年电商采购加盟合作合同
- 村居便民服务工作制度
- 村所室内消杀工作制度
- 预防接种查验工作制度
- 公路危大工程监理实施细则
- 2026安徽省供销集团有限公司集团本部招聘7人笔试参考题库及答案解析
- 2026年山西药科职业学院单招综合素质考试题库及答案详解(基础+提升)
- 福利院食品卫生安全制度
- 餐饮后厨消防安全考试题
- 5G通信网络规划与优化-课程标准
- 肾单位模型改进课件
- 茶楼劳动合同
- 中数联物流运营有限公司招聘笔试题库2026
- 高压线路新建监理规划书
- 科主任临床科室管理
评论
0/150
提交评论